Animation… Movie #119 2021: Madagascar (2005) 6 May 202130 Apr 2021 There’s just something about DreamWorks’ animated features that make me feel disinterested. Not only have Pixar conquered the (non-musical) animated movie world to near perfection, but smaller studios - such…